随着生活水平的提高,人们越来越注重对自己生活品质和个人健康的重视。作为清洁牙齿的工具,人们对牙刷的要求也越来越高,电动牙刷的普及率也逐渐的高了起来。
电动牙刷大致分为两类,一类就是旋转式,就是利用电机使得刷头旋转,从而实现和人手工刷牙类似的效果。还有一类就是超声波。它是利用线圈里的电流的高频变化,从而使得磁铁吸合产生振动,进而通过机械结构带动刷头也产生高频振动以实现清洁牙齿的目的。
旋转式牙刷的电路结构比较简单,这里就不做过多的分析。本文重点介绍超声波式的电动牙刷的电路图的原理与构成。由于我用的牙刷是飞利浦的soniccare系列的牙刷,所以本文的电路图也以它为例子。
Soniccare的牙刷外形如图所示:
图1
拆开的电路板的外形如图所示
图2
基本上的结构可以分为充电部分和电池,MCU部分,线圈驱动部分,按键和LED部分。
网上已经有人把这个电路板的原理图画了出来,我们下面的分析就以这个电路图为蓝本。但是这个原理图上的器件很多没有标明具体的型号,同时对于U2的猜测我觉得也是不对的。这里我根据PCB上的器件的丝印信息重新进行了梳理,列出了大部分器件的型号,同时对于原理进行了比较详尽的说明。
充电部分,这个还是比较简单的。他分为整理部分和充电控制部分。
首先是整流部分,L2通过充电线圈感应得到交流的信号,如果要使得它可以给充电电池充电,必须把它变为直流。CR6就是一个整流芯片。从下面两张图大家就可以很清楚的了解它的原理。
下面这部分是一个充电控制电路,由2个三极管组成的一个控制电路,由来自MCU的P22控制充电电路的导通与关断。当电池的电量已经充满的时候,P22可以输出一个低电平,使得Q3的PNP管关断,从而切断充电电流。
电池通过一个F1的保险丝就在VCC上。从而实现过流保护功能,这个充电电池用的是Sony的。
MCU部分,这个MCU是用PIC16F芯片。它有8Kx14的flash和B的RAM。它来控制充电,模式的选择,案件的控制和线圈的驱动控制。
这里有一个U2没有标注型号,通过我的研究,它应该是一个I2C接口的一个EEPROM。为什么这么说呢,因为它的两个接口P14,P15正好对应着MCU的I2C的功能引脚。
线圈控制电路。从下图可以看出,L1就是红色的大线圈。
需要给这个大线圈以非常高频的交变电压。如何实现这种控制呢,我们用了一种H桥的方式。下图展示了如何在电感两端产生交变的电压。
从上图可以看出交替的打开桥式电路的对角线的电子开关就可以实现上述功能。在电路上,开关是由mosfet来实现的。这里的Mosfet从图中可以看出,他们的型号是TSCSD和TSCSD。
从电动牙刷的结构上看,线圈产生磁性,在磁极相反的时候会和磁铁相吸;在磁极相同的时候会和磁铁相斥,进而通过机械机构在牙刷头上产生出高频的振动。
总的来说,电动牙刷的控制部分原理不是很复杂。但是从网上查到的资料看,飞利浦的soniccare电动牙刷的机械部分还是比较复杂,且是申请了专利了的。